Foreign Antigens
Substances from outside the body that can induce an immune response.
Foreign Substances
Materials or particles that are not recognized as part of the body, often invoking an immune response.
MAC
Membrane attack complex (MAC) is a structure formed on the surface of pathogenic bacteria as part of the immune system's response, leading to the lysis of these cells.
Cytokines
A broad category of small proteins that are important in cell signaling, released by cells and affecting the behavior of other cells, and often acting as immunomodulating agents.
